Renewable energy and energy efficiency finance specialist with 19+ years' experience in the renewable energy and energy efficiency sector in the United States, Spain, Russia, Poland, Czech Republic, Slovak Republic, Estonia, Lithuania, Latvia, Spain, Argentina, Dominican Republic, Chile and Hungary.
Jose Luis was an early leader in the renewable energy and energy efficiency sector in Central and Eastern Europe, where he started up and served as Managing Director of Honeywell ESCO Polska, a subsidiary selling renewable energy and energy efficiency financial services and financing large systems and energy services projects in Poland, Hungary and Czech Republic. These services were developed in conjunction with the International Finance Corporation (IFC) and the European Bank for Reconstruction and Development (EBRD).
Jose Luis also led Honeywell's effort to create an Energy Performance Contracting business within the European organization, including founding several ESCOs in Central and Eastern Europe and the acquisition of an existing ESCO company in Poland.

More recently, as principal and founder of GreenMax, he has led the GreenMax Strategic Marketing Planning team to advise the International Finance Corporation (World Bank) on marketing its Commercializing Renewable Energy and Energy Efficiency Finance (CEEF) program in Central and Eastern Europe. This team has produced extensive market research to identify the most promising segments for energy finance and strategy for implementation of the program. This included the development of marketing tools for international financial institutions (IFIs), and identification of the specific renewable energy and energy efficiency market promotion needs of each country. The latest assignments have also included a study determining baseline CO2 emission reduction for several types of renewable energy and energy efficiency technologies. These advisory services have resulted in the doubling of the project pipeline for this financial product in the region and equally doubling the emission reductions of GHGs generated by those projects.

Additionally, Jose Luis leads the international business development of Fersa Energías Renovables S.A., which since 2006 has generated and pipelined assets in: China, India, Russia, Poland, Estonia, France, Italy, Panamá and Montenegro. He serves as member of the Board of Directors of Fersa and Member of Board of Est Wind Power.
